Once I became curious about costs and performed my own due diligence, I realized that the world looks different through a different lens. Yes, “trusting but verifying” occasionally creates surprising findings and new realities.

In other words, I realized the value of what’s called Value Engineering. That is, providing the product or end result that is desired but via a different path from point A to point B and saving money along the way.

But Value Engineering concepts can’t stand on their own. They need the concepts of Building Science to perform a reality check.

Q: 1. Why?

2. What is Building Science?

A:  1. So you don’t do stupid things. (Trust me – I was stupid first).

2. Building Science is the physiology of how buildings work, from keeping the outside out to keeping the inside in. The principles of Building Science follow from The Second Law of Thermodynamics, contrived in part by French scientist Sadi Carnot, German scientist Rudolph Clausius, and British scientist William Thomson.

(The concepts of building science are also introduced in the book I referenced above.)

Q:  How do Value Engineering and Building Science work together?

A:  Let me count thy ways:

Value Engineering says, hey, lumber is expensive now, you should consider steel studs. Building Science responds with, “Have you ever heard of the concepts of thermal bridging and conductivity?”

Value Engineering says, I think it would be a lot cheaper to run those ducts through the attic or crawl space. Building Science says, “Whoa horsey, get a grip, get a clue, and hold my beer.”

Value Engineering says, I don’t need to install a vent for that combustion fireplace. In fact, the manufacturer’s label says it’s OK to use in an unvented manner. Building Science says, “Learn about Indoor Air Quality because that plan is the dumbest I’ve ever heard.”

Value Engineering says, Let’s throw recessed can lights in that cathedral ceiling so you have the highest possible ceiling and headroom clearance. Building Science smirks and replies, “Only if you know what you’re doing.”

Value Engineering says, I am designing this home with 1½ baths because the extra full bath does not justify the cost. Building Science raises its eyebrows and says, “Your water rectangle is in excess of 90% of your enclosure’s footprint. I can design you a home with 2½ baths for less money now and later.”

Are you beginning to get the picture? Yes, either one by itself is better than neither; but their sum is infinitely better than any other way of looking at things.
